The Magic of Floating Your Krathong
One of the most captivating aspects of the Ayutthaya Loi Krathong festival experience is undoubtedly the act of floating a krathong. These beautiful, handcrafted floats—typically made from banana leaves, flowers, and candles—are set adrift on rivers and canals. It's a symbolic gesture to pay respect to the Water Goddess, Phra Mae Khongkha, and to let go of misfortunes. From my perspective, preparing your own krathong adds a deeper personal connection to the ritual. Many vendors offer pre-made krathongs, but seeking out a workshop to craft one yourself truly enhances the experience. This tradition forms the spiritual heart of the festival, creating a mesmerizing spectacle on the water as countless tiny lights drift into the night. It's a moment of quiet reflection amidst the general festivity.

Best Spots to Celebrate in Ayutthaya
Choosing the right location significantly enhances your Ayutthaya Loi Krathong festival experience. While the entire city participates, certain spots offer unparalleled ambiance. The Ayutthaya Historical Park is often the epicenter, with the most organized events and stunning backdrops of ancient ruins. Specific temples like Wat Chaiwatthanaram or Wat Phanan Choeng along the Chao Phraya River provide picturesque settings for floating krathongs, with fewer crowds. For a more local feel, venture to smaller canals or temple grounds away from the main tourist areas. Practical Tips for a Memorable Experience
To ensure your Ayutthaya Loi Krathong festival experience is truly memorable, a few practical tips can make all the difference. Firstly, dress respectfully, covering your shoulders and knees, especially when visiting temples. Wear comfortable shoes as you’ll be doing a lot of walking. Arrive early at popular spots to secure a good viewing location, as crowds can gather quickly. Consider staying overnight to fully absorb the evening's magic and avoid rush hour traffic. From my travels, I've learned that carrying small denominations of Thai baht is useful for street vendors and local transport.
